site stats

Rbtree github

WebSee the GNU General Public License for more details. You should have received a copy of the GNU General Public License along with this program; if not, write to the Free Software Foundation, Inc., 59 Temple Place, Suite 330, Boston, …

GitHub - c-util/c-rbtree: Intrusive Red-Black Tree Collection

WebAn iterator over the nodes of a [`RBTree`]. Reorders the elements of this iterator in-place according to the given predicate, such that all those that return true precede all those that … WebThus, reading registers from the device will always return what was last written. Therefore we can save a lot of time when reading registers by using a regmap_cache. Since the register map is relatively large, but we only ever access … sonic megamix apk android https://foreverblanketsandbears.com

红黑树的实现(C++)_青衫客36的博客-CSDN博客

WebReturns a tuple of tree elements: a mutable reference to left node, mutable right node and mutable referent to the value stored inside the current node. WebJun 7, 2024 · Package rbtree implements operations on Red-Black tree. Details. Valid go.mod file . The Go module system was introduced in Go 1.11 and is the official … Web* * ----- */ #ifndef NASM_RBTREE_H #define NASM_RBTREE_H #include #include /* This structure should be embedded in a larger data structure; the final output from rb_search() can then be converted back to the larger data structure via container_of(). */ struct rbtree { uint64_t key; struct rbtree *left, *right; bool red; }; struct … sonic megamix box art

[PATCH v2 0/9] faster augmented rbtree interface

Category:Re: [PATCH v2 3/9] rbtree: add __rb_change_child() helper function ...

Tags:Rbtree github

Rbtree github

liubinyi/red-black-tree-js - Github

WebLKML Archive on lore.kernel.org help / color / mirror / Atom feed From: Rik van Riel To: Michel Lespinasse Cc: [email protected], [email protected], [email protected], [email protected], [email protected], [email protected], [email protected], torvalds@linux … WebApr 13, 2024 · 【代码】红黑树的实现(C++) C++红黑树零、前言一、红黑树的概念及性质二、红黑树结点的定义三、红黑树的插入操作1、变色处理2、单旋+变色3、双旋+变色4、插入实现四、红黑树的验证五、红黑树的删除六、红黑树与**AVL**树的比较 零、前言 本章继AVL树后继续讲解学习C++中另一个二叉搜索树– ...

Rbtree github

Did you know?

WebThe c-rbtree project implements an intrusive collection based on red-black-trees in ISO-C11. Its API guarantees the user full control over its data-structures, and rather limits itself to … W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

WebApr 4, 2024 · Contribute to ysj1173886760/TinyKV development by creating an account on GitHub. simple single-node kv-storage inspired by leveldb. ... class RBTree: public … WebJan 14, 2024 · They're rare and aren't needed in the rbtree anyway. One caveat, this actually might not end up being the right fix. Non-empty overlapping symbols, if they exist, could have the same ... diff --git a/tools/objtool/elf.c b/tools/objtool/elf.c index be89c74..f9682db 100644--- a/tools/objtool/elf.c

WebRBTree Animation Y. Daniel Liang. Enter an integer key and click the Search button to search the key in the tree. Click the Insert button to insert the key into the tree. Click the Remove … Web[PATCH 13/13] rbtree: optimize color flips in __rb_erase_color() Michel Lespinasse Mon, 09 Jul 2012 16:37:10 -0700 In __rb_erase_color(), when the current node is red or when flipping the sibling's color, the parent is already known so we can use the more efficient rb_set_parent_color() function to set the desired color.

WebJan 30, 2024 · GitHub is where people build software. More than 100 million people use GitHub to discover, fork, and contribute to over 330 million projects. Skip to content …

WebIt expects values and keys to be sorted, but if presort is true, it will sort keys and values using the comparator (in-place!). You can only use it on an empty tree. RBTree.createTree … sonic megamix maniaWeb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. sonic megamix websiteWebrbtree.blog. [email protected]. rbtree. Seoul. I started my information security study from a university club called PLUS in POSTECH, South Korea. I mainly focused on reverse … small image of hollyWebFor the insertion operation itself, this essentially reverts back to the implementation before commit 7c84d41416d8 ("netfilter: nft_set_rbtree: Detect partial overlaps on insertion"), except that cases of complete overlap are already handled in the overlap detection phase itself, which slightly simplifies the loop to find the insertion point. sonic megamix mania twitterWebRBTree.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als … sonic megastore near meWebAug 28, 2024 · Red-black tree ADT. Contribute to vikman90/rbtree development by creating an account on GitHub. small images are calledWebFor augmented rbtree users, no inlining takes place at this point (I may propose this later, but feel this shouldn't go with the initial proposal). Patch 9 removes the old augmented rbtree interface and converts its only user to the new interface. Overall, this series improves non-augmented rbtree speed by ~5%. small image of earth